WebOct 13, 2024 · Capping the last show of the 40th Anniversary Tour with Tom Petty & the Heartbreakers, Petty performed his final song on stage the night of Sept. 25, 2024. Before blasting into the classic anthem "American Girl," Petty acknowledged the sold-out crowd at the Hollywood Bowl in southern California. "We love you dearly,'' he said.
